🔷🔷 About 🔷🔷

This Fundamental Cryptography in Theory and Python lesson is the 2nd of 2 parts demonstrating, how SHA-256 as a hash function can be implemented in Python straight out of the official standardization document NIST FIPS PUB 180-4.

In this second part, the implementation of the SHA-256 hash computation is demonstrated.
